Karyn Ingalls Jewellery Maker

As a jewellery maker I love the process of making! I can get “lost” in my studio for hours. Colour and texture are important elements of my work. The flowers in my garden and the dynamic colours and light of the ocean provide an abundant source of inspiration. To create my pieces I use a variety of techniques; fold forming, enameling and metal clay, resulting in one of a kind and limited edition jewellery.
